The cumulative frequency curve shows the ages of the 80 members of a club. Use the curve to estimate the interquartile range of the ages.

Diagram for ECZ · Paper 1
  • A. 10 years
  • B. 20 years
  • C. 25 years
  • D. 45 years

Verified working — step 1

The lower quartile is read at a cumulative frequency of a quarter of 80, which is 20, giving 25 years. The upper quartile is read at three quarters of 80, which is 60, giving 45 years. The interquartile range is 45 − 25 = …
